Herschel intercepts asteroid Apophis

Wednesday, January 9, 2013 - 07:00 in Astronomy & Space

ESA’s Herschel space observatory made new observations of asteroid Apophis as it approached Earth this weekend. The data shows the asteroid to be bigger than first estimated, and less reflective.
